" My blog is carbon neutral " is an initiative born in Germany within the "Make it Green " which aims to reduce emissions of carbon dioxide. Each visit to a blog produces about 0.02 g of carbon dioxide. Imagine how much we produce every day. They will then offer to plant free of charge for blogs that will participate in the initiative, a tree that will neutralize the traces left by the blog for the next 50 years !
To participate is very simple: just create a post dedicated to the initiative and send the link to this email address: CO2-neutral@kaufda.de . They provide a nice tree to plant for us.
When I read on the website that the first part of the initiative has gone very well and that will resume in April 2011 reforestation of the Plumas National Forest. Intan are looking for new forests available for planting new trees!
